Traveling among the tribes in the Upper Missouri area during the 1830s, Swiss artist Karl Bodmer painted spectacular landscapes and striking portraits of Native Americans. This superb collection reproduces 24 paintings from that magnificent series, including Mandan Shrine, Teton Sioux Woman, Buffalo and Elk on the Upper Missouri, and Skin Lodge of an Assiniboin Chief.
